1. Belynda SPEUILL

5905 glenwood rd apt 1d Brooklyn New York New York Map United States 11234 Leave message Background check

2. Belynda Speuill

5905 glenwood rd apt 1d Brooklyn New York Map United States 11234 Leave message Background check

3. BELYNDA SPEUILL

5905 glenwood rd apt 1d Brooklyn NY Map United States 11234 Leave message Background check